The clerk of the superior court, after an order setting a contest for trial, shall issue a citation to both parties containing a copy of the order. He or she shall deliver it to the sheriff who shall serve it either upon the parties or leave it at the residences named in the affidavits of registration of the parties.
Cal. Elec. Code § 16521
Contest Procedures at Primary Elections: Contests Other Than Recount
Amended by Stats. 1996, Ch. 1143, Sec. 63
